Who This Is For
This service is for families or couples dealing with:
- Active alcohol or drug dependence in a loved one
- Recovery and relapse cycles
- Breakdown in communication, trust, or co-parenting
- Emotional burnout, fear, or resentment
- A desire to understand addiction and respond more effectively
You don’t have to wait until the person using is “ready” to get support. Sometimes, helping yourself first is what opens the door for change.

What Family & Couples Counseling Includes
We create a safe, neutral space for honest conversations — and support each participant’s perspective without assigning blame.
Sessions may include:
Education on addiction as a behavioral and mental health issue
Communication tools to reduce conflict and increase clarity
Strategies for setting healthy, consistent boundaries
Repairing trust and addressing unresolved pain
Supporting your loved one’s recovery without losing yourself in the process
Navigating co-parenting or caregiving roles
Developing a shared vision of recovery and accountability

How We Work With Families
Every family is unique. We tailor our counseling approach based on:
- Family structure (parents, couples, teens, siblings, caregivers)
- Stage of substance use or recovery
- Willingness and readiness of each participant
- Co-occurring mental health or behavioral challenges
- Cultural, relational, or language needs
